Godeok Station is a subway station on Seoul Subway Line 5 in Gangdong District, Seoul.[1][2][3] It links to Baejae High School, Myungil High School, Gwangmun High School, Hanyoung High School, and Hanyoung Foreign Language High School. It will be part of Seoul Subway Line 9 in 2028.[4]
